    Problem-solving skills are essential for children aged 6-9, especially when learning to add numbers to 1000 with regrouping. These foundational skills lay the groundwork for mathematical understanding and critical thinking. Mastering regrouping enhances computational fluency, enabling children to perform addition with larger numbers accurately and confidently.

    By engaging in problem-solving activities focused on this skill, children develop patience and resilience. They learn to tackle complex tasks step by step, nurturing a growth mindset that encourages perseverance in the face of challenges. Furthermore, these activities integrate logical reasoning, encouraging children to apply mathematical concepts to real-world situations, thereby enhancing their understanding.

    For parents and teachers, fostering these skills not only supports academic success but also promotes overall cognitive development. Recognizing the significance of a solid mathematical foundation, educators can implement engaging strategies to inspire learners. When children successfully master regrouping, it boosts their self-esteem, making them more enthusiastic about learning and problem-solving.

    In essence, instilling strong problem-solving skills in children during this crucial developmental stage ensures they are well-prepared for advanced math concepts and life challenges ahead, ultimately leading to lifelong learning and successful futures.
